Keyboard Shortcut: Press Ctrl + D (Windows) or Command + D (Mac) on your keyboard. This shortcut will instantly duplicate the selected shape.
Click the shapes icon in the Insert tab and choose the shape you wish to draw in the corresponding menu. Then the cursor will change into a cross and you can draw the desired shape.
Ctrl + D (PC) / ⌘ + D (Mac): Duplicates an object and shifts it slightly down and to the right. Ctrl + Shift + Drag (PC) / ⌘ + Ctrl + Shift + Drag (Mac): Duplicates an object in place so that you create a copy and then drag the shape to wherever you want it to be.
Select the shapes to be aligned, click the Drawing Tooltab, and then click the Alignbutton. In the Align drop-down menu, you can set the alignment as needed. Merge shapes Select the shapes you want to merge: press and hold the Ctrl key while you select each shape in turn. On the Shape Format tab, in the Insert Shapes group, select Merge Shapes to see a menu of merge options. Select the Merge option you want.
Keyboard shortcuts Select the shape you want to copy formatting from, then press Ctrl+Shift+C. Select the shape you want to copy formatting to, then press Ctrl+Shift+V.
